ncbi summary :
This gene encodes a member of the cytochrome P450 superfamily of enzymes. The cytochrome P450 proteins are monooxygenases which catalyze many reactions involved in drug metabolism and synthesis of cholesterol, steroids and other lipids. This protein localizes to the endoplasmic reticulum and catalyzes the last steps of estrogen biosynthesis. Mutations in this gene can result in either increased or decreased aromatase activity; the associated phenotypes suggest that estrogen functions both as a sex steroid hormone and in growth or differentiation. Alternative splicing results in multiple transcript variants. [provided by RefSeq, May 2014]
uniprot summary :
CYP19A1: Catalyzes the formation of aromatic C18 estrogens from C19 androgens. Belongs to the cytochrome P450 family. Protein type: Lipid Metabolism - androgen and estrogen; EC 1.14.14.14; Oxidoreductase. Chromosomal Location of Human Ortholog: 15q21.1.
